Trials in civil cases

Mesothelioma lawsuits can be complicated. However, most cases are settled before trial. If a case does go to trial the jury will decide what amount of compensation the victim is entitled to. The verdict of a trial may be appealed. This could delay the payment of compensation by months or even years.

Personal injury lawsuits make up the majority of mesothelioma lawsuits filed in the United States. They seek financial compensation for victims' medical bills as well as lost wages and other. Compensation from a mesothelioma suit will not restore health or bring back the lost loved one, however it can help victims and their families receive the best care possible.

The discovery stage of a mesothelioma lawsuit can take months as lawyers collect evidence and testify. A mesothelioma attorney will interview current and former workers who may have valuable information on asbestos exposure. The lawyer will also collect medical records to prove that asbestos exposure is the cause of mesothelioma. At this point, a client may be asked to take an interview that is recorded and played to the jury in the case of a trial.

Wrongful death claims seek compensation for the loss of a loved one to mesothelioma, or another asbestos-related illness. These lawsuits seek justice by holding accountable individuals accountable for their negligence in exposed victims to asbestos. These lawsuits are filed by spouses or children, as well as other dependents who have lost loved ones.

A mesothelioma attorney can also help victims determine how much compensation they are entitled to receive. The compensation from a mesothelioma suit can include economic, non-economic, and punitive damages. Economic damages can include past and future medical costs loss of wages, funeral expenses. Non-economic damages may include pain and discomfort, loss of consortium and emotional distress. Punitive damages are designed to discourage asbestos companies from engaging in fraudulent, oppressive or grossly negligent behavior.

In addition, m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ims and their families in filing claims for wrongful death. Wrongful Death claims are similar to personal injury lawsuits and seek compensation for the loss of a loved one's death caused by asbestos exposure. These claims can be made by the spouses, children, or other family members who were close to asbestos victims.
